As Fenerbahçe continues its squad planning for the upcoming season, an important development is taking place in the goalkeeper position. It has been claimed that Croatian goalkeeper Dominik Livakovic wants to leave the team, and the expected transfer fee has also been determined. It has been suggested that Livakovic wishes to continue his career in Spain's La Liga, and that his agent is searching for a club in Spain.
After the points loss in the match against Kayserispor, Fenerbahçe's chances of winning the championship have become more difficult, and preparations for the squad planning for the next season are continuing at full speed.
